Abstract

Nowadays, ethanol is an attractive renewable energy that can be produced from multi-purpose materials such as rice, sweet sorghum, sugar cane or even substrates from food industrial waste. Ethanol is not only produced in large scale by industry but it is also produced in small scale by SME or small agricultural community. This article, the simple homegrown pot distillery was developed to increase the distilled ethanol concentration by mimic fractional distillation. The distillation column in 20 cm of height and 6 cm of diameter was designed and applied for single homegrown pot in 1.8 litter of total volume. Column was consisted of 7 trays which each tray had 40 pores in 3mm of diameter, and condensate tubes. The experiment tests were done by using 12 vol.% of absolute ethanol and fermented sugar cane medium from yeast Saccaromyces cerevisiae fermentation at 8 vol.% of ethanol concentration. The effect of distillation temperature control by using 1.5 litter of 9 vol.% absolute ethanol was determined at 90°C at inside the pot, 80°C at top of distillation column and uncontrolled temperature. The results showed that the average of distilled ethanol at 34 vol.% was detected. The distillation was done for 272 min and yield of distilled ethanol was 13.33%. The controlled at 80°C, the average distilled ethanol concentration was 38.2 vol.%, for 269 min. The yield of distilled was 16%. Meanwhile, the uncontrolled distillation had average concentration at 36.35 vol.% of ethanol, 17.33% of yield, for 119 min. However, the efficiency of fermented medium distillation was a smaller higher than distillation of diluted ethanol. They were 39.5 vol. % of distilled ethanol, 17.33% of yield, for 194 min. Moreover, the efficiency of absolute ethanol distillation was compared with native homegrown pot at same concentration of 12 vol.% ethanol. The modified distiller pot had higher efficiency of distillation than native pot. These were distilled ethanol concentration at 44.2 vol.%, 16.67 % of distilled yield, for 159 min whereas native distillation showed 37 vol.% of distilled ethanol, 15.33 % of distilled yield and over 240 min.
